Odyssey Institute saw some tournament action on Saturday. They fell just short of the Nogales Apaches by a score of 15-13.
Jaden Schwartz and Maya Carmouche did some serious damage despite the final result: Schwartz scored three runs while going 3-for-3, while Carmouche scored three runs while going 3-for-4. Those three hits gave Schwartz a new career-high. Kaitlyn Lopez was another key player, scoring two runs while going 1-for-1.
Even though they lost, Odyssey Institute was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.583. Their batting average was a full 0 higher than the also-impressive .409 that Nogales posted.
Odyssey Institute's defeat dropped their record down to 2-2. As for Nogales, the victory (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 4-1.
Odyssey Institute has already played their next contest, a 14-2 loss against Wickenburg on the 3rd. As for Nogales, they also w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next match, a 10-4 defeat against St. Mary's on the 1st.
